Product Range and Specialties of Ducoo Precision Machining Parts Co.

The listed aluminium CNC parts cover turning, milling and lathe operations, typical for aerospace, automotive and equipment manufacturers. In the industry aluminium machining commonly uses alloys such as 6061‑T6 or 7075‑T6, with tolerances of ±0.02 mm and surface roughness (Ra) from 0.4 µm to 1.6 µm depending on end use. Anodised aluminium parts usually meet ISO 7459 surface finish standards and are supplied in finished colour grades. Precision steel components are generally machined from carbon or alloy steels (e.g., 1045, 4140) with hardness ranges of 30‑45 HRC. Sheet‑metal machining components often adhere to thickness tolerances of ±0.1 mm and may be supplied in cold‑rolled or hot‑rolled grades.

Sourcing from Ducoo Precision Machining Parts Co. - Buyer Guidance

When evaluating Ducoo’s aluminium CNC parts, request a material test report confirming alloy designation (e.g., 6061‑T6) and a dimensional inspection report showing achieved tolerances. For anodised items ask for an anodising thickness measurement (typically 10‑20 µm) and colour match documentation. Steel parts should be accompanied by a hardness certificate and, if applicable, a heat‑treatment record. Verify whether the supplier can provide ISO 9001 certification or a similar quality‑system audit report before placing a large order. Confirm packaging details, container loading plan and lead time, which for CNC‑machined components in China usually ranges from 15 to 30 days after design approval.
